The Role
As a Network Engineer, you will join our team supporting QinetiQ and MOD customers. You'll work in an ITIL-based environment supporting multiple projects across different layers, delivering technical outputs that ensure secure, efficient transfer of data and the delivery of key communications and network systems. Day-to-day, you'll work closely with project managers and technical leads to deliver quality outputs, assist with system implementations and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ives, develop processes, and support the team by sharing knowledge, providing practical solutions, and help maintain high standards.
- Investigate and resolve technical issues across existing networks and systems
- Support multiple projects and ensure timely delivery of technical outputs
- Implement and configure new systems and solutions
Essential experience of the Network Engineer:
- Hands-on experience in networking, IT and communications
- Prior experience as a network engineer within an IT department
- Support an existing Juniper SRX based network with cyber patches/issue investigation as and when needed (using VPNs, VLANS, within ESXi server environment)
- Understanding of Microsoft, Windows, Linux, Juniper or coding environments would be advantageous
- Ability to investigate problems and provide solutions to complex network issues
- Professionalism and experience in a structured IT environment
Essential qualifications for the Network Engineer:
- Degree in engineering or equivalent IT-related experience
